Savor Local Culture Through Artisan Shops and Craft Boutiques
In Amish Country Ohio, hidden gems lie in the most delightful corners—especially in the village of Millersburg and its surrounding towns. Just minutes from The Inn at Honey Run, this region’s spirit is reflected in its handcraft shops, family-owned stores, and creative studios rooted in time-honored traditions.
Start your day at Starlight Antiques, a beloved Millersburg destination where vintage finds sit alongside handmade gifts and nostalgic collectibles. Around the corner, New Towne Gallery displays exquisite work from Ohio-based painters and mixed media artists—many drawing inspiration from local landscapes.
If high-quality furniture and craftsmanship catch your interest, head to Homestead Furniture in Mount Hope. There, Amish artisans produce heirloom pieces, seamlessly blending traditional techniques with modern style. Further exploring regional flair, Lehman’s Hardware in Kidron is a multi-sensory shopping experience. Originally designed for Amish customers, it now enchants visitors with sustainable tools, rare kitchenware, and living-history charm.
Charming Local Shops Worth a Visit:
- The Garden Gate – This Berlin floral boutique showcases fresh arrangements, cozy home décor, and seasonal delights.
- Village Gift Barn – A three-floor shop filled with farmhouse décor, hand-poured candles, and woven Appalachian textiles.
- Miller’s Dry Goods – Located in the village of Charm, this beloved fabric store has supplied quilters with thousands of bolts and notions since 1965.

Quiet Trails and Untouched Nature Just Beyond the Inn
Beyond the serene trails around The Inn at Honey Run, you’ll discover even more hidden gems in Amish Country Ohio—each one inviting slower movement and reflection in nature.
Just a 10-minute drive away, the Kokosing Gap Trail begins in Danville and winds through scenic hardwood groves, passing railroad bridges and peaceful riverbanks. It’s ideal for walkers, cyclists, and anyone seeking calm, paved paths beneath tree-lined skies.
For deeper immersion, explore Mohican State Park. With its sweeping forest trails and the dramatic Clear Fork Gorge, it offers a back-to-nature experience perfect for hiking, birdwatching, or mindful walks.
Closer to the Inn, Rails to Trails Holmes County offers more than 15 miles of dual-lane paths. As horses and buggies travel alongside cyclists, you’ll witness the harmonious rhythm of new and traditional lifestyles sharing the land.
Prefer to stay close? The Holmes County Open Air Art Museum, located right on The Inn’s grounds, merges artistic expression with woodlands. Sculptures appear along nature trails, each framed by rustling leaves and the soft sounds of birds—an inspiring union of creativity and environment.
Outdoor Tips to Enhance Your Amish Country Adventure:
- Wear layers—the region’s temperatures shift throughout the day, especially during spring and fall.
- Carry a reusable water bottle and nourishing snacks to enjoy on peaceful trails.
- Explore at sunrise or near sunset to catch golden light and tranquil air.

Unexpected Culinary Gems Across Amish Country Ohio
Many travelers are pleasantly surprised by the culinary hidden gems Amish Country Ohio has to offer. While known for classic comforts, the region boasts an impressive variety of flavors—both traditional and refined.
At the heart of it all is Tarragon at The Inn at Honey Run. This seasonally inspired restaurant elevates local ingredients into thoughtfully composed dishes. Under the direction of Executive Chef Bret Andreasen, meals are artfully presented to delight every sense. Dining on the terrace, with the forest just beyond, is unforgettable.
In town, Bags Sports Pub in Millersburg serves reinvented pub classics with regional flair. It may look simple from the outside, but locals know it as a go-to spot for hearty, flavorful fare. Berlin’s Boyd & Wurthmann Restaurant is a slice of local history. Known for generous breakfasts and fresh-baked pies, it’s a favorite among Amish and visitors alike.
For cheese and chocolate lovers, no visit is complete without stopping by Heini’s Cheese Chalet for free samples of handcrafted dairy delights. Nearby, Guggisberg Cheese is famed as the birthplace of Baby Swiss. Cap off your day with treats from Coblentz Chocolate Company, where family recipes turn into delicious caramels and truffles made on-site.
